irish ike, SASS #43615 Posted February 3, 2022 Share Posted February 3, 2022 I'm not sure if you're shooting long range, accurately, but Starlines 40-65 brass are short. Theres a note on the page for them. .015 to .020 short. I ended up using 45-70 and reshaping them.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

Clyde Henry #7046 Posted February 3, 2022 Share Posted February 3, 2022 My son shoots BPCR Silhouette using Starline 40-65 brass. The cases are short, but I don't think it makes that much difference. He is currently a AAA class shooter and has only one more Master Class score to go before he will be re-classed to the Master category, and he only uses Starline 40-65 cases.
